Trip to Ribeirao Preto

Find the perfect accommodation on booking.com

Great location and deals for every budget.

6 ways to travel from Sao Joao da Boa Vista to Ribeirao Preto

Compare travel options and prices to find best route from Sao Joao da Boa Vista to Ribeirao Preto

calendar-icon